Abstract
Systems and methods are disclosed for maintaining security and data gathering for a number of vehicles. The systems include a vehicle activity module for each of the vehicles. The vehicle activity module has a wireless transmitter, a storage device, at least one sensor for receiving event information from identification devices, such as RFID cards, keypads, magnetic ID cards, and the like, a releasable key container, and a processor for accessing and analyzing information. The VAMs are wirelessly connected to a computer system. The VAMs control access to the keys, monitor information relating to access, and store and transmit information relating to sales events, non-sales events, and intrusion events. The VAMs are capable of autonomous operation, without the need to access the computer system to verify event information. The VAMs further include signal attenuating mechanisms to facilitate use of “smart keys.”

1. A system for maintaining security and gathering data involving a plurality of remote locations comprising:
-
a plurality of activity modules, each of which are assigned to one of a plurality of remote locations, at least one of said plurality of activity modules including a storage device capable of receiving and storing data, a wireless transmitter, at least one sensor, a releasable key container configured to receive at least one key, and a processor operably coupled to;
(i) said wireless transmitter, (ii) said at least one sensor, and (iii) said releasable key container;a computer having a database for storage of data, said computer being in wireless to communication with said at least one of said plurality of activity modules; and at least one key identification device for attachment to said at least one key of at least one of said plurality of remote locations; wherein;
(a) said processor is capable of receiving and transmitting event information to at least one of said storage device and said computer from said at least one sensor; and
(b) said processor is programmed to access and analyze said event information and compare said event information to reference information stored in said storage device for initiation of an event action within said at least one activity module. - View Dependent Claims (2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 12, 13)
